Job Description

Seeking a Staff Data Engineer who has experience integrating data using modern data integration tools and techniques.

The ideal candidate should be proficient with creating tables, writing stored procedures, functions and building ETL/ELT jobs to load data from disparate systems.

The Staff Data Engineer will be loading data to and from a variety of sources including data marts and transactional applications with conventional ETL/ELT patterns as well as modern data streaming or messaging patterns.

Key Responsibilities :

- Develop and maintain high-performance code based on SQL Server stack, including Stored Procedures, Views, Functions, and table design for transactional and analytic purposes.

- Develop and maintain Extract Transform Load jobs (ETL/ELT) and other data integrations with real-time streaming and API based sources.

- Develop new data solutions and migrate existing on-premise data solutions to cloud platforms including Azure Databricks and pyspark.

- Mentor and assist with the technical development of teammates, assist with code and technical reviews.

- Participate in backlog grooming and other agile ceremonies as a technical lead.

- Create Continuous Integration and Continuous Delivery (CI/CD) pipelines to automate delivery of solutions.

- Provide support for data solutions, including remediation of failed ETL jobs, integrations and investigation of data quality issues.

- Data modeling for transactional and analytical platforms.

- Work directly with stakeholders to gather requirements and provide status updates and solution support.

- Ensure data solutions meet or exceed enterprise regulatory and compliance requirements.

Qualifications :

- Bachelor's degree in business, computer science, computer engineering, electrical engineering, system analysis or a related field of study, or equivalent experience.

- 6+ years experience using Microsoft SQL Server or equivalent RDBMS.

- 6+ years experience building data integrations leveraging ETL tools such as SSIS or Databricks.

- Proven knowledge of data integration patterns including ETL/ELT, event messaging and APIs.

- Familiarity with database change capture tools including Change Tracking and Change Data Capture.

- Familiarity with data modeling patterns for OLAP and OLTP workloads.

- Familiarity with Master Data Management concepts and platforms.

- Familiarity with data product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C).

- Excellent communications skills.

- Excellent analytical and technical skills.

- The ability to work in a collaborative team environment
